What they do

A Family or Behavioral Therapist works with clients who need help dealing with emotional disorders or problems with family and relationships. Addresses client problems in the context of family relationships; helps clients develop ways to recognize and change behavior patterns. Works with individuals, couples or families.

About our Practice Time For A Change Counseling is a trauma informed group practice specializing in children and families navigating behavioral crisis, big emotions, and the effects of trauma. We are growing, and we are looking for a fully licensed clinician who wants to do meaningful work with the support of a practice that understands the field from the inside out. About the Role This is a full time W2 position for a mental health professional who holds is independently licensed in Mississippi (LPC, LCSW, LMFT). You will carry a caseload of individual clients and have the opportunity to lead therapeutic groups for children. This role is credentialed with insurance panels, giving you access to a steady referral base rather than relying solely on self pay. What You'll Do Provide individual trauma informed therapy to children and families Facilitate therapeutic groups, six to eight week series focused on emotional regulation and behavioral support Conduct intake assessments and develop individualized treatment plans Maintain timely, compliant clinical documentation Collaborate with our team on case consultation and client care Represent the practice's values and clinical approach in the community What We're Looking For Active, unrestricted licensure in Mississippi (LPC, LCSW, or LMFT) Experience working with children, adolescents, or families, trauma informed background strongly preferred Comfort with both individual and group therapeutic formats Strong documentation and time management skills Alignment with a compassionate, practical, non judgmental approach to care RPT or interest in play therapy is a plus but not required Benefits Insurance credentialing support provided Professional development and continuing education support Paid time off for birthday Opportunity to grow within the practice as we expand, including potential involvement in our training Schedule Full time, in office, Brookhaven location. Some evening availability required (at least 2 nights per week) to accommodate client and family schedules.
